We hope. If you've spent an autumn or longer in Southern California, we're counting on the fact that you've spent a day in the old-west-y mountain town that's just a hop and a scootch from San Diego. So you know Julian. And you know that, regardless of season, you can find apples in town. Apple t-shirts and apple sachets and coffee mugs covered in cartoon apples. So. Apples everywhere. But, come fall? Apple onslaught. Apples every which way you turn. Apple pie and apple everything. It makes us happy, and lots of people happy, and it makes Julian one bustling little village. If you want to be in the middle of all of the whole pectin party, be there on Saturday, Oct. 1 and Sunday, Oct. 2. That's the weekend of Julian Apple Days.

APPLE MONTHS: We should note that Julian keeps the apple-y goodness going for the better part of October and November; you'll just want to check the schedule before making the drive. The Oct. 1 and 2 weekend, however, will boast family-nice activities and more.
